The adjustment brush presets should be under 'Presets' in your screenshot. Also note that you have no mask selected.

Also on Mac, Command + Shift + 4 creates a crosshair that you can drag to capture a section of screen. It's saved to the desktop by default. Use the image icon in the text editor to add this directly in the preview.
